Gaslighting: The Silent Soul-Taker
Gaslighting is a form of psychological manipulation where a person or group makes someone question their perceptions, memories, or understanding of events. This is achieved by denying facts, twisting reality, or lying. Over time, the victim may lose their sense of self and reality, feeling as if their soul is being slowly taken away.
Narcissistic Abuse: Soul-Crushing Manipulation
Narcissistic abuse involves a narcissist manipulating and exploiting their victim for their own gain, without regard for the victim's feelings or well-being. This can involve constant criticism, invalidation of feelings, and a lack of empathy, leading to the victim feeling emotionally and spiritually drained.

Preventing and Recovering from Soul-Taking
Preventing soul-taking involves maintaining strong boundaries, surrounding oneself with supportive people, and trusting one's instincts. If you or someone else is experiencing emotional or spiritual harm, seek help from a mental health professional. Recovery involves rebuilding self-esteem, re-establishing connections with others, and regaining a sense of purpose.
